MNELAB

MNELAB is a graphical user interface for MNE-Python (the most popular Python package for EEG/MEG analysis).

Key features include:

  • Cross-platform support (Linux, macOS, Windows).
  • A command history that records the underlying MNE-Python commands for each action, allowing users to learn how to use MNE-Python and to reproduce their analyses in code.
  • Import data from various formats supported by MNE-Python, and some additional formats like XDF, MATLAB, NumPy, and BVRF.
  • Export to EDF, BDF, BrainVision, EEGLAB, and FIFF formats.
  • XDF-specific features such as chunk inspection (useful for debugging corrupted XDF files), stream selection, metadata inspection, resampling, gap detection and filling, and more.
  • Support for various ICA algorithms, including FastICA, Infomax ICA, and PICARD.
  • Automatic classification of independent components using ICLabel.
  • Comprehensive tools for managing events and annotations.
  • Support for channel locations (montages), re-referencing, cropping, filtering, epoching, and more.
  • Plotting functions for raw data, epochs, evoked responses, independent components, ERD/ERS maps, and more.

Quick Start

We recommend using the standalone installers for macOS and Windows:

If you use Arch Linux, you can install MNELAB from the AUR (e.g., yay -S python-mnelab).

Alternatively, you can use uv to run MNELAB directly without installing it (this works on all platforms, but for the best experience we recommend using the standalone installers when available):

uvx mnelab

Advanced Usage

To run the latest development version:

uvx --from https://github.com/cbrnr/mnelab/archive/refs/heads/main.zip mnelab

On Linux, running MNELAB via uvx mnelab uses the Fusion style shipped with PySide6, which may not fit well with the rest of the system. However, if you use KDE, you can set the QT_PLUGIN_PATH environment variable to force the use of the native KDE theme instead, for example:

QT_PLUGIN_PATH=/usr/lib/qt6/plugins uvx mnelab
